WebApr 16, 2024 · A blend of Italian seasoning, sugar,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, pepper, and dried thyme give this classic Italian beef flavor. No need for the dressing mix. Provolone. No Italian beef sandwich is complete without a melty cheese. Provolone has a slight smokiness that I think pairs wonderfully with the beef. Hoagie Buns. WebSep 28, 2024 · To do this, we’ll quickly turn liquid fat (also known as tallow) from solid beef fat trimmings (also known as suet). Trim the fat from raw beef steaks and roasts, or get some cheaply from the butcher. This can be done gradually, with the remainder being frozen. Only 1/4 pound is needed for this. In a saucepan over medium high heat, combine the water, salt, black pepper, oregano, basil, onion salt, garlic and salad dressing mix. Stir well and bring to a boil.
